متن کاملIncidence of pulmonary embolism during COPD exacerbation*, **
OBJECTIVE Because pulmonary embolism (PE) and COPD exacerbation have similar presentations and symptoms, PE can be overlooked in COPD patients. Our objective was to determine the prevalence of PE during COPD exacerbation and to describe the clinical aspects in COPD patients diagnosed with PE. متن کاملExacerbation frequency and FEV1 decline of COPD: is it geographic?
Ch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) exacerbations are episodes of symptom worsening that have major impacts on a variety of health outcomes, including quality of life, hospital admission and death [1]. متن کاملPredictive accuracy of patient-reported exacerbation frequency in COPD.
Ch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) exacerbation frequency is important for clinical risk assessment and trial recruitment.
